Oprah Winfrey is at home recovering from the brutal fall she had on stage last week, and says she is icing her injuries. But, it's not the remedy that is impressive it's the futuristic machine she is using that is the unbelievable. You have to see this!

The billionaire television mogul posted a picture on Instagram sitting in her home reading a newspaper with the caption, "Sunday Reading and icing. Thank you all for your kind wishes. Yes I slipped on stage and I’m now a meme. But so grateful to be only a little sore. Turning the day into what @michelleobama calls #selfcareSunday"

As you know, Oprah took a terrible spill on stage last week and landed very hard on her right side. But, when you are rich and powerful as Ms. Winfrey, you don't just wrap a bag of peas around your knee like the rest of us!

Take a hard look at the contraption she has around her leg. It is a 'Game Ready' GR Pro 2.1 System, which is a high-tech machine that combines compression therapy with cold air to treat your injury.

Let us try and explain, basically, this machine cools down the air inside the machine with ice, then presses the air through a sleeve that is wrapped around your injured body part. At the same time, it pulses with compressions that help the area heal.

According to its website, the machine, "combines a powerful control unit with a complete range of innovative, circumferential wraps to integrate active cold and intermittent pneumatic compression therapies with greater adjustability, comfort, and convenience than ever before. The easy-to-use, portable system out-cools the competition, taking RICE (Rest-Ice-Compression-Elevation) to the next level for your injury or surgery recovery."

The only issue with this futuristic, awesome looking machine is that you will have to fork over a pretty penny to get one for yourself. Several retailers online are selling these babies for $2,000-$3,000 bucks!

As we reported, Oprah took a nasty nosedive during a speech at The Forum in Inglewood, CA. Ironically, she was talking about balance at the exact moment she took the spill.

In the video, captured by Los Angeles Times en Español, Oprah wobbles taking a few steps before all of the sudden crashing down on the stage. "Wrong shoes!" she said as the crowd laughed along with her and as she kept going with her speech.
